Permanent Secretary for Commerce, Trade, Tourism and Transport Shaheen Ali says the opening of the new Digicel flagship store at TappooCity Suva indicates confidence in the capital by the teleco provider.
The outlet which was a $250,000 investment opened yesterday on the ground floor of the iconic building.
It boasts an additional business solutions hub expanding Digicel’s one-stop-shop concept.

This is the sixth store in Suva and the 17th one across the country.
“What we are seeing today is more than just another year of progress,” Mr Ali said.
Progress not only for Digicel but progress for our city, progress for our people, our economy and of course, our strength in terms of connectivity, he said.
